Frontend разработка
Веб-верстка
Познакомишься с HTML и CSS, кроссбраузерной и адаптивной вёрсткой.
Создание приложений на стороне пользователя
Научишься создавать интерактивные пользовательские интерфейсы, освоишь работу с модулями, событиями и менеджерами пакетов npm.
UX/UI дизайн
Научишься составлять портреты пользователей и разрабатывать Customer Journey Map, поймешь, как делать удобные и понятные интерфейсы, опираясь на исследования.
Реализуется в дисциплинах: практикум по программированию, проектный практикум.
Профессиональное программирование на C#
Алгоритмы и структуры данных
Научишься использовать управляющие конструкции: ветвление и циклы, массивы, методы, файлы, коллекции.
Объектно-ориентированное программирование на C#
Освоишь визуальное программирование, основы технологии Windows Presentation, глубокое погружение в ООП, делегаты, многопоточность, паттерны.
MonoGame
Познакомишься с единым фреймворком для создания кроссплатформенных игр на С#.
Реализуется в дисциплинах: программирование на языке высокого уровня, объектно-ориентированный анализ и программирование на языке C#, проектный практикум.
Разработка Web приложений
Продвинутая вёрстка HTML + CSS, Bootstrap
Познакомишься со всеми нюансами кроссплатформенной и кроссбраузерной вёрстки и научишься учитывать все особенности браузеров для вёрстки сложных многостраничных сайтов.
Продвинутый JS, React.js
Освоишь навыки работы с DOM, организации Unit тестирования, работы с HTTP и реализации таких функций сайта, как Drag&Drop, анимация CSS и многое другое.
Backend
Вы изучите один из самых популярных фреймворков для разработки бэкенда на ASP.NET. Познакомишься с возможностями фреймворка, научишься создавать контроллеры для обработки внешних запросов, Создашь базу данных для сайта.
Реализуется в дисциплинах: разработка Web-приложений, Web-дизайн, разработка интерфейсов, проектный практикум.
Разработка мобильных приложений
Архитектура
Научишься проектировать архитектуру мобильных приложений: хранение данных, переходы между пользовательским экранам, передача данных между сервером и клиентской частью.
Разработка на React.js
Узнаешь, как разработать своё мобильное приложение с помощью JS. Научишься разрабатывать клиент-серверную архитектуру на React.js.
Разработка на Xamarin
Научишься создавать мобильные приложения на языке C# под Android и iOS, используя фреймворк Xamarin.
Реализуется в дисциплинах: разработка мобильных приложений, разработка интерфейсов, проектный практикум.
Проектирование и разработка баз данных
Архитектура
Научишься проектировать архитектуру баз данных любой сложности для хранения данных пользователей.
Запросы
Научишься составлять запросы к базам данных для фильтрации и управления данными внутри таблиц.
Роли (Администрирование)
Научишься администрированию баз данных, созданию новых пользователей, устанавливая им роли разного уровня доступа к таблицам и базам данных.
Реализуется в дисциплинах: базы данных, проектирование информационных систем, проектный практикум, информационная безопасность.
Управление разработкой цифрового продукта
Проектирование архитектуры информационных систем
Научишься последовательно и эффективно проектировать архитектуру информационных систем для решения проблем.
Современные технологии управления проектом.
Познакомишься и/или получишь навыки работы с современными технологиями управления проектами Scram, Miro, Canva, Trello и инструментами JetBrains.
Управление командой
Узнаешь, как планировать ресурсы и время команды от планирования до реализации проекта. Поймёшь, как развивать ресурсы команды, анализировать работу команды, мотивировать команду на конечный результат.
Реализуется в дисциплинах: Проектирование информационных систем, программная инженерия, разработка и управление продуктом на основе пользовательского опыта, основы управления цифровыми сервисами.
Основы Frontend разработки
Веб-верстка
Вы Познакомишься с HTML и CSS, кроссбраузерной и адаптивной вёрсткой.
Создание приложений на стороне пользователя
Создашь интерактивные пользовательские интерфейсы, освоишь работу с модулями, событиями и менеджером пакетов npm.
UX/UI дизайн
Научишься составлять портреты пользователей и разрабатывать Customer Journey Map, поймешь, как делать удобные и понятные интерфейсы, опираясь на исследования.
Реализуется в дисциплинах: практикум по программированию, проектный практикум.
Основы программирования
Алгоритмы и структуры данных
Научишься использовать управляющие конструкции: ветвление и циклы, массивы, методы, файлы, коллекции.
Объектно-ориентированное программирование на C#
Освоишь визуальное программирование, основы технологии Windows Presentation, глубокое погружение в ООП, делегаты, многопоточность, паттерны.
MonoGame
Познакомишься с единым фреймворком для создания кроссплатформенных игр на С#.
Реализуется в дисциплинах:программирование на языке высокого уровня, объектно-ориентированный анализ и программирование на языке C#, проектный практикум.